#d90d1c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d90d1c is composed of 85.1% red, 5.1%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94% magenta, 87.1%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 355.6 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 45.1%. #d90d1c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1a38 with #b30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

Shades and Tints of #d90d1c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0102 is the darkest color, while #fffaf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#d90d1c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#786e6f is the less saturated color, while #e20414 is the most saturated one.
